Output e0e6172d330d4115e3e99bc2de47c8b2d744c6bc0afc2218c8ebd8a43e003ae6:0

value
516350142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
e0e6172d330d4115e3e99bc2de47c8b2d744c6bc0afc2218c8ebd8a43e003ae6
confirmations
515099
spent
true